Guidance & FAQs

To help you prepare your move please ensure you have considered the following points and answers to our FAQ’s which contain lots of important information

  • Plan in advance – packing up and cleaning your accommodation takes longer than you may think. Look out for important guidance from the Property Team to help you with your plans and preparations
  • Be prepared with boxes and anything else that will help you move your possessions.
  • Please remember that you will need to bring your own cleaning materials so that you can return your accommodation to the original standard.
  • Make preparations to empty your fridge/freezer and use up food before your departure date
  • Follow any instructions regarding your end of tenancy, cleaning, mail redirection etc. which will be sent by email. Please also check FAQ’s below
  • To avoid congestion it is recommended  you only have one other person assist you with your move and no more than one vehicle.
  • VERY IMPORTANT: Please ensure you return your keys before departing. If you have any doubt about where to return these, please contact us using the Accommodation Support Form

 It is your responsibility to ensure the following cleaning is carried out:

  • Plan ahead – Sort through your belongings; if you will be disposing of items in waste/recycle bins do this as soon as possible and don’t leave this to your move out date. Donate items to charity in advance of your moving out date.  Use up food or donate to food banks.  
  • Clean your bedroom and en-suite (if you have one) thoroughly, including vacuuming flooring: remove all your rubbish & personal items.

    Check and clean inside of drawers, behind furniture and under bed. Clean all surfaces.

  • Clean your communal kitchen/ pantry thoroughly, including oven, hob, microwave & fridge /freezer (where applicable) note, please do not switch off your fridge/freezer, staff will defrost this for you: remove all of your rubbish & personal items, including items in food lockers. Use up food from fridge/freezer and cupboards before moving out.  Ensure your freezer drawers can be opened; if your freezer drawers are iced over, you may need to defrost your freezer before departing so you can remove food. Contact us using the Accommodation Support Form if you need advice on this.  Clean inside of kitchen units and fridge/freezer

  • Clean any shared bathroom/shower room (where applicable) thoroughly.
  • Take down posters or any other items: please do so carefully, as any damage to walls or paintwork WILL result in a charge. Clear all personal items and rubbish from communal areas including pantries, kitchens, drying rooms, laundry and any other storage or communal areas. 
  • Please ensure all the furniture is in the correct rooms and location
  • When you are cleaning and packing, please ensure that you open your window.

You should remove all rubbish and recycling and place into the appropriate bins, which are usually located at the front of the building or in the bin store area.

If you do not know where your binstore is, please contact us using the Accommodation Support Form

For any rubbish left, you will be charged £10 per bag for us to remove it.

Yes, it is very important that you have packed everything and take it with you as any items left in your room or communal areas will be disposed of.

If you do leave items in your room, we will charge £10 per bag to clear your room.  Please be aware that charges will also apply to cover any costs associated with returning the flat/ room to the condition it was in when you arrived.  This could include cleaning fees and repairing any damage.

We ask that you remove any rubbish and food left in the cupboards/ fridges/ freezers to ensure that nothing remains after the last resident departs.

Charges will apply as follows;

  • Individual charge to bedroom resident where bedroom is not cleared and cleaned to original condition
  • Shared charges to all household residents where communal areas have not been cleared and cleaned to original condition

Unwanted duvet and pillows should be put into a clear bag and left in common room or Re-use collection point.  Please look out for information displayed around site.  Please do not give us your bedsheets, duvet cover, pillow cases or towels.

Please speak with a member of staff for provision of clear bags.

Do not use black bags as these will be classed as rubbish and disposed of as general waste.

YES – this is extremely important.

Please contact us using the Accommodation Support Form if you need an envelope for key return or confirmation of your key return location.

You must move out by 10am on your lease end date.

This means you’ve removed your belongings, completed cleaning and returned keys by this time/date.

If you are currently still living in your accommodation and are not able to leave your accommodation and travel home by your  lease end date then please do let us know using the Accommodation Support Form and we will get in touch to advise you can stay or if there is  alternative accommodation we can offer 

Please be aware that, should you require accommodation beyond your lease end date, you may be required to move to one of our other accommodation locations.

Charges Sheet 22/23

Prices are correct as of September 2022 - PLEASE NOTE THEY MAY BE SUBJECT TO CHANGE.

Please find below some representative costs of household replacements, cleaning and maintenance charges.  The minimum cost for any item is £5.00, and all costs include an administrative charge of 25%. REMOVAL COSTS FOR DAMAGED ITEMS OF FURNITURE MAY ALSO BE CHARGEABLE. The age of the item will be taken into consideration when charging, and the full replacement charge may not always be payable. This list is not exhaustive, for items, not listed quotes will be obtained.
